Chen Tianshi, Chairman and CEO, Cambricon Technologies (China), ranks #216/520 on the AI Advancement Index (71.9). Known for Co-designed the DianNao/DaDianNao family of deep learning accelerators (pioneering academic neural-network chip architectures); founded Cambricon, one of China's leading AI chip companies.

Ideas & positions

Chen Tianshi is a proponent of advancing AI through specialized hardware, particularly in the development of efficient and scalable deep learning accelerators. He co-designed the DianNao/DaDianNao family of chips, which are foundational in the field of neural network processing. Chen founded Cambricon Technologies to commercialize these innovations, aiming to make AI more accessible and powerful. He emphasizes the importance of hardware-software co-design to optimize performance and efficiency in AI systems. While he has not publicly taken strong stances on existential risk, open vs closed models, or regulation, his focus on practical applications and technological advancement suggests a pragmatic approach to AI development.
